Views ile "Yazar Bilgisi" Bloğu (Drupal 7) | Drupal Dersleri

Gönderi Bilgileri
Mediasaur kullanıcısının resmi
Mediasaur
15.09.2013 - 00:37

Bu Drupal dersi için temel Drupal bilgilerine; içerik türü, kullanıcı rolleri, Views vd. ilgili konularda temel bilgi ve deneyimine sahip olduğunuz varsayılmıştır.

Views ile "Yazar Bilgisi" Bloğu

Bu Drupal dersinde amaçlanan, içerik gösterilirken içeriğin yazarı hakkında bilgiler içeren bir bloğu da göstermek.

  1. Admin > Structure > Views bölümünden "Add new view" bağlantısına tıklayarak bir view(görünüm) oluşturmaya başlayın.
    1. "View name" kutucuğuna "Yazar Bilgisi" yazın.
    2. [Tercihe bağlı adım.] "Description" bölümünü işaretleyip View için bir açıklama girebilirsiniz. İşaretleyip açılan kutucuğa "Yazar hakkında bilgiler." yazın.
  2. "Show" açılan menüsünden(drop-down) "Users" seçeneğini seçin.
  3. Create a page seçeneğinden işareti kaldırın.
  4. "Create a block" seçeneğini işaretleyin. Blok adı otomatik olarak gelecektir; isterseniz değiştirebilirsiniz. Diğer seçenekleri değiştirmeye gerek yok.
  5. "Continue & edit"e tıklayın. Bu aşamada emek kaybı olmaması için, view'u kaydetmek üzere "Save" düğmesine tıklayın.
  6. FIELDS bölümünde "add" bağlantısına tıklayarak dilediğiniz diğer User alanlarını ekleyin(E-mail, Picture, field olarak eklediyseniz Adı Soyad vd.)
    1. Sağdaki "Advanced" kısmına tıklayın.
    2. RELATIONSHIPS bölümündeki "add" bağlantısına tıklayın.
    3. Açılan "Add relationships" penceresinde "User: Content authored" seçeneğini işaretleyin.
    4. "Apply" düğmesine tıklayın.
    1. RELATIONSHIPS bölümündeki "add" bağlantısına tıklayın.
    2. Açılan "Add relationships" penceresinde "Content: Author" seçeneğini işaretleyin.
    3. "Apply" düğmesine tıklayın.
    1. CONTEXTUAL FILTERS bölümündeki "add" bağlantısına tıklayın.
    2. Açılan "Add contextual filters" penceresinden "Content: Nid" seçeneğini işaretleyin.
    3. "Apply" düğmesine tıklayın.
    4. WHEN THE FILTER VALUE IS NOT AVAILABLE bölümünde "Provide default value" seçeneğini işaretleyin.
    5. "Type" açılan menüsünden "Content ID from URL" seçeneğini seçin. f) "Apply" düğmesine tıklayın.
  7. "Save" düğmesine tıklayıp view'u kaydedin.
Temel Bilgiler
İlgili Eklenti(ler): 
Drupal Sürümleri: